首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

微商城数据库设计mysql

数据库是一个用于存储和管理数据的系统,可以用于存储微商城中的各种数据,包括用户信息、商品信息、订单信息等。MySQL是一种常用的关系型数据库管理系统,广泛应用于各种应用领域。

在微商城的数据库设计中,可以包括以下几个主要的表:

  1. 用户表(user):用于存储用户的基本信息,包括用户ID、用户名、密码、手机号码、邮箱等。可以使用MySQL的用户表设计来创建该表,可以使用腾讯云的云数据库MySQL来存储该表,具体可参考腾讯云数据库MySQL的产品介绍:腾讯云数据库MySQL
  2. 商品表(product):用于存储商城中的商品信息,包括商品ID、商品名称、商品价格、商品描述、库存数量等。可以使用MySQL的商品表设计来创建该表,并使用腾讯云的云数据库MySQL来存储该表。
  3. 订单表(order):用于存储用户的订单信息,包括订单ID、用户ID、商品ID、订单状态、订单金额等。可以使用MySQL的订单表设计来创建该表,并使用腾讯云的云数据库MySQL来存储该表。

通过以上几个表的设计,可以满足微商城的基本数据库需求。当然,根据实际情况,还可以添加其他表来存储更多的信息,比如收货地址表、购物车表等。

在设计微商城数据库时,需要考虑以下几个方面:

  1. 数据库的范式设计:根据业务需求和数据特点,选择合适的范式设计,以减少数据冗余和提高数据的一致性。
  2. 数据库的性能优化:通过建立合适的索引、优化查询语句等方式,提高数据库的读写性能。
  3. 数据库的安全性:采取必要的安全措施,如限制数据库用户权限、加密敏感数据等,以确保数据的安全性。

腾讯云提供了云数据库MySQL的服务,可以满足微商城的数据库存储需求。通过腾讯云数据库MySQL,可以实现高可用、高性能的数据库服务,并且提供了灵活的扩展和备份恢复功能。具体了解腾讯云数据库MySQL,可访问腾讯云官网:腾讯云数据库MySQL

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 领券